Question Inter Coolers on a 575 Merc?

Has anyone done inter coolers on these motors?

Is straight bolt on or do you have to mess with the computer to tune them?

Does anyone make a kit for them?

Is there any noticable differance?

Default Re: Inter Coolers on a 575 Merc?

I've done several of them. Whipple makes a complete kit. I did them on a 42 Fountain and a 38 Scarab. Both owners were very happy, picked up about 4 MPH. I can sell you the kit if you need a source. The kit is a straight bolt on, but you must send the ECU to Whipple for reprogramming. You will need a scan tool to get it timed correctly. There are a couple of tricks you need to know when installing them to make life easier, but it's basically an intake manifold change and some plumbing.
